AN ACT relating to governmental administration; prohibiting
governmental entities from entering into certain
nondisclosure or confidentiality agreements; declaring
certain records relating to a predecisional or deliberative
process of the governmental entity concerning a rul e,
ordinance or regulation are public records; and providing
other matters properly relating thereto.
Legislative Counsel’s Digest:
Existing law provides that, unless otherwise declared by law to be confidential, 1
all public books and records of a state o r local governmental entity are required to 2
be open at all times during office hours for the public to inspect, copy or receive a 3
copy thereof. (NRS 239.010) Section 1 of this bill prohibits a governmental entity 4
from entering into a nondisclosure or confidentiality agreement unless the 5
information required to be kept confidential is otherwise made confidential 6
pursuant to state or federal law. 7
Section 2 of this bill declares that a record that pertains to a predecisional or 8
deliberative process between a governmental entity and a private person or entity 9
concerning a rule, ordinance or regulation which the governmental entity is 10
considering adopting is a public record. 11

Section 1. Chapter 237 of NRS is hereby amended by adding 1
thereto a new section to read as follows: 2
1. A governmental entity shall not enter into a nondisclosure 3
or confidentiality agreement unless the information that will be 4
– 2 –
- *SB296*
kept confidential by the agreement is otherwise made confidential 1
pursuant to state or federal law. 2
2. As used in this section, “governmental entity” has the 3
meaning ascribed to it in NRS 239.005. 4
Sec. 2. Chapter 239 of NRS is hereby amended by adding 5
thereto a new section to read as follows: 6
1. Notwithstanding any other provision of law, a record that 7
pertains to a predecisional or deliberative process between a 8
governmental entity and a private person or entity who is not 9
employed by or actively under cont ract with the governmental 10
entity concerning a rule, ordinance or regulation which the 11
governmental entity is considering adopting is a public record. 12
2. Nothing in this section shall be construed to deem a 13
predecisional or deliberative record of a governmental entity a 14
public record when the record was shared solely between 15
governmental entities or within a governmental entity. 16
Sec. 3. The amendatory provisions of this act do not apply to 17
any contract entered into before October 1, 2025. 18
